Applied Behavior Analysis (3rd Edition) by John O. Cooper, Timothy E. Heron, William L. Heward
Applied Behavior Analysis (3rd Edition) is the authoritative resource for understanding and applying the principles of behavior analysis across educational, clinical, and organizational settings. Written by renowned experts Cooper, Heron, and Heward, this edition integrates conceptual, empirical, and practical elements essential for behavior analysts, educators, and students alike.
Highlights:
- Aligned with the Behavior Analyst Certification Board® BCBA/BCaBA Task List (5th ed.)
- Includes over 1,000 new citations from contemporary research in behavior analysis
- Features contributions from leading scholars on ethics, verbal behavior, motivating operations, and more
- Presents detailed examples, graphs, and procedures grounded in real-world practice
- Supports development of technical fluency, data-driven decision-making, and ethical competence
- Organized for foundational coursework, supervised practice, and certification preparation
Who It’s For:
Students, clinicians, educators, researchers, and certification candidates in applied behavior analysis seeking a rigorous and practical foundation in the science of behavior.

ASCE 24-14: Flood Resistant Design and Construction, 2014
ASCE 24-14: Flood Resistant Design and Construction provides minimum requirements for the planning, design, and construction of buildings in flood-prone areas. Referenced by the International Building Code (IBC) and the National Flood Insurance Program (NFIP), this standard supports floodplain management regulations and promotes resilience through engineering best practices.
Highlights:
- Defines Flood Design Class (1–4) to guide risk-based design criteria
- Specifies elevation requirements based on flood hazard zones, building type, and occupancy
- Includes wet and dry floodproofing methods for commercial and residential applications
- Updates flood opening requirements including engineered vent systems and louvers
- Provides structural design standards for Coastal A Zones and coastal high hazard areas
- Identifies acceptable flood damage-resistant materials and construction techniques
- Covers tanks, utilities, egress, garages, and parking structures in flood-prone zones
- Offers guidance for substantial improvements and retrofitting of existing buildings
- Coordinates with ASCE 7 and NFIP regulations to ensure code consistency and compliance
Who It’s For:
Essential for civil engineers, architects, code officials, and builders involved in flood zone development, permitting, and compliance with FEMA, IBC, and local floodplain standards.
